    Getting There

    Car

    If you are driving from central Osumi, take Route 220 heading towards Kagoshima. Continue for approximately 30 kilometers until you reach the city of Kagoshima. Once in Kagoshima, follow signs for Route 10, then take the exit for Shiroyamacho. Mount Shiroyama is located at 22 Shiroyamacho, Kagoshima, 892-0853. There is parking available near the entrance to the park.

    Public Transportation

    From Osumi, take a local bus to Kagoshima City. You can catch the bus from the main bus terminal in Osumi. Once you arrive at the Kagoshima Bus Terminal, transfer to the City Tram (Kagoshima City Transportation Bureau). Board the tram heading towards Shiroyama. Get off at the 'Shiroyama' stop. From there, it is a short walk to Mount Shiroyama, located at 22 Shiroyamacho, Kagoshima, 892-0853. Be prepared to walk uphill for a short distance to reach the main area of the mountain.

    Discover more about Mount Shiroyama

    Mount Shiroyama, a prominent landmark in Kagoshima, is not just a mountain; it’s a journey through history and nature. This majestic site, once home to a castle, now serves as a popular tourist attraction that provides visitors with stunning panoramic views of the surrounding landscape, including the iconic Sakurajima volcano. The lush greenery and diverse flora make it an ideal spot for hiking enthusiasts and nature lovers alike. The trails leading to the summit are well-marked and range from easy walks to more challenging hikes, ensuring that every visitor can find a suitable path to enjoy.As you ascend Mount Shiroyama, you'll encounter several lookout points where you can pause to take in the breathtaking views. On a clear day, the sight of Sakurajima rising from the sea is truly unforgettable, and the vibrant sunsets that paint the sky with hues of orange and pink are a photographer’s dream. The historical significance of the site adds to its charm; remnants of the castle foundations can still be seen, providing a glimpse into Kagoshima’s past.Visitors flock to Mount Shiroyama not only for its natural beauty but also for its cultural significance. The area is rich in history, and guided tours are available for those who wish to delve deeper into the stories behind this remarkable site. Whether you’re an avid hiker or simply looking for a serene escape from the city, Mount Shiroyama offers a perfect blend of adventure and tranquility, making it a must-visit destination in Kagoshima.
